There are more benefits of hiring a virtual office assistant; here are just a few examples to consider:
1. Reduced labour costs

On the other hand, virtual assistants work as independent contractors. This means they handle all their own expenses, including taxes, medical aid and pension / provident funds. You simply hire them to perform a specific job, pay them for their time, and that’s it. Think of all the money you’ll save that can be better used elsewhere!
2. Increased productivity
In a standard 8-hour workday, the average office worker does less than 5 hours of actual "productive" work. Why pay one more employee to surf the internet and chat at the coffee station? Virtual assistants work differently. Without the distractions of an office environment, they’re able to focus and dedicate their time to getting tasks done. Because they’re self-employed, their number one goal is client satisfaction. If they start slacking off and missing deadlines, it’s unlikely the company will hire them for future work, this resulting in a loss of income for them. For this reason, virtual assistants are a highly motivated bunch!
3. Increased flexibility
With a VA, you’re not saddled to a 9-5 workday. They work around your schedule and are there when you need them. If you’re in different time zones, that can work to your advantage, too. Rather than assigning eight-hour shifts, you can develop a schedule that maximizes output while keeping costs in check.
